Ferrara/KME are premiere manufacturers of fire trucks and emergency response vehicles offering a full line of pumpers, aerials, industrial, wildland, and rescue apparatus. Working hands-on with both municipal and industrial fire departments, the Ferrara/KME team thrives on diagnosing departments' current apparatus limitations and response needs to custom design the perfect fire apparatus solution that will stand the test of time. Ferrara/KME is part of Terex Corporation, a global designer and manufacturer of specialized vehicles and equipment, including fire and emergency vehicles, waste and recycling equipment, RVs, and machinery supporting construction, utilities, and infrastructure.

Responsibilities

  • Polish sanded surfaces using an electric buffer and compounds with cloth or foam wheels.
  • Remove masking after paint or apply masking prior to a process.
  • Sand surfaces or parts using mechanical or hand sanding.
  • Sand or grind areas to remove sharp edges, burrs, or defects in preparation for paint.
  • Perform assembly or disassembly in areas of job function as required.
  • Wash, wax, and clean exteriors, interiors, and engine compartments using various cleaners and equipment.
  • May perform other duties as assigned.
